Estelle Sawyer Obituary

Estelle (Regopoulos) Sawyer, 69, of Fitchburg passed away early Tuesday morning in the arms of her adoring husband after a 21 year, hard fought battle, with scleroderma. Estelle was the centerpiece of her family. She was known for her immense strength, positivity, love for her friends, family, and her faith. Estelle will forever be remembered for her smile that lit up the world. 

Estelle was born October 27, 1954, to the late Angelo and Sophie Regopolous in Fitchburg. Estelle grew up in Leominster where she worked at Whalom Park and then at Demoulas where she met the love of her life, Chuck, in 1970. She graduated from Leominster High School in 1972. After starting her family, Estelle attended Fitchburg State College where she earned a bachelor’s degree and a master's degree in education. She became an educator for the Fitchburg Public Schools where she would retire from over 30 years later, touching the lives of thousands of children from kindergarten to middle school. Her middle schoolers would know her as the driver of the “Big Green Blazer”. She not only left her mark on her students but that of her coworkers as well. She was always there to lend a helping hand, an ear to listen, or a hand to hold.  

She was an active member of the Holy Trinity Greek Orthodox Church in Fitchburg and was a Sunday School teacher for many years.  

After retiring in 2014 Estelle could be found laughing and living life with her crew, Lea Schuren, Betty Berthiaume, and the late Bonnie Sweatman, or walking and chatting with friends. She enjoyed reading, doing crosswords, sudoku, and playing word games on her phone. She cherished her road trips to Florida with her husband where she would explore, relax on the beach, and spend time at the hockey rink where she would cheer on her grandson, Nickolas. But above all, she took pride in watching over her family and friends.
